Yes, but only in the right context. The A17 Pro and Snapdragon 8 Gen 2 are no longer current flagship chips in 2026, yet they still power many well-supported premium phones. The comparison remains useful for buyers choosing between an iPhone 15 Pro or 15 Pro Max and Android phones such as the Galaxy S23 Ultra or OnePlus 11, especially in the used and refurbished market.
Apple's A17 Pro generally leads in cross-platform CPU benchmarks, particularly single-core performance. Snapdragon 8 Gen 2 remains capable for demanding Android games, cameras, multitasking and emulation, but performance varies more widely because it was used in many phones with different cooling, memory and software choices.
This is not a chip-only buying decision. A17 Pro is closely tied to Apple's hardware and iOS, while Snapdragon 8 Gen 2 appears in a wide range of Android phones. Camera systems, battery condition, display, software support, carrier compatibility and local warranty matter more in 2026 than a single benchmark score.
Core Chip Differences
Apple says A17 Pro uses a six-core CPU and a six-core GPU in the iPhone 15 Pro lineup. Snapdragon 8 Gen 2 uses Qualcomm's eight-core Kryo CPU, Adreno 740 GPU, Hexagon AI engine and X70 5G modem platform.

What the Scores Mean in Daily Use
A17 Pro's single-core advantage can help with short bursts of demanding work, app responsiveness, complex web pages and certain creative workflows. Apple also designed the A17 Pro around hardware-accelerated ray tracing, USB 3 transfer support and higher-end mobile games.
Snapdragon 8 Gen 2 is still far from slow. It was Qualcomm's premium Android platform and supports features including Wi-Fi 7, 5G, UFS 4.0 storage, hardware ray tracing and advanced camera processing. In a well-cooled phone, it can still handle modern games, high-resolution video, navigation and multitasking comfortably.
The meaningful difference in 2026 is more likely to appear in sustained workloads, demanding games, large video exports or future AI features than in messaging, browsing and social apps. For ordinary daily use, both platforms remain more than fast enough.

A17 Pro Has a Platform Advantage, Not Just a Benchmark Advantage
A17 Pro is not available as a standalone Android-style platform. It appears in Apple's iPhone 15 Pro and iPhone 15 Pro Max, where Apple controls the chip, operating system, drivers and many app-development targets.
That close integration can benefit video workflows and Apple games. It also means an A17 Pro buyer is choosing iOS, Apple's service ecosystem and the iPhone 15 Pro camera system, not merely selecting a processor.
Snapdragon 8 Gen 2 gives Android buyers more hardware choice. It appears in compact phones, large-screen flagships, gaming phones and foldables. This flexibility can produce better battery capacity, faster charging, a telephoto camera, a larger display or more RAM depending on the phone.
Is Snapdragon 8 Gen 2 Still Good in 2026?
Yes. A Snapdragon 8 Gen 2 phone can still be a good purchase in 2026 if its battery health is sound, it continues to receive security updates, and its price reflects its age. The same is true for A17 Pro devices.
Buyers should not assume that a later Android version or iOS version automatically delivers every new AI feature. Some features depend on specific hardware, language availability and manufacturer decisions. Update policies are set by phone makers, not Qualcomm or Apple Silicon alone.

FAQ
Is A17 Pro faster than Snapdragon 8 Gen 2?
A17 Pro generally scores higher in cross-platform CPU tests. In the specific Geekbench 6 phone examples used here, the iPhone 15 Pro scored higher in both single-core and multi-core performance than Galaxy S23 Ultra and OnePlus 11 examples using Snapdragon 8 Gen 2.
Is Snapdragon 8 Gen 2 still good for gaming in 2026?
Yes. It remains capable for current Android games, especially in phones with good cooling. Newer chips may offer higher performance and efficiency, but Snapdragon 8 Gen 2 is still a premium-class platform.
Which phone gets the higher Geekbench score?
The iPhone 15 Pro A17 Pro sample scored 2,958 single-core and 7,529 multi-core. The Galaxy S23 Ultra sample scored 1,792 and 5,103. The OnePlus 11 sample scored 1,920 and 4,986.
Does A17 Pro guarantee better gaming performance?
No. Game availability, operating system, graphics settings, device temperature and software optimisation all matter. The A17 Pro is strongest within Apple's iOS ecosystem, while Snapdragon phones offer broader Android and emulator flexibility.
Is it worth buying either chip in 2026?
It can be, particularly in a discounted or refurbished phone with good battery health and a remaining support window. Compare the full phone, software policy, condition, local warranty and current price before deciding.
Bottom Line
A17 Pro has the stronger CPU benchmark position and remains a good reason to consider an iPhone 15 Pro or iPhone 15 Pro Max in 2026. Snapdragon 8 Gen 2 remains a capable Android platform that offers more variety in phone design, gaming features and hardware options.
The comparison is still worth making when choosing older premium phones. It is not enough to pick a winner by chip name alone. The best choice depends on iOS versus Android, the exact phone's battery and cooling, its software support and the standard price and warranty available in your market.
